## Limits: Log Compaction

The Relaypipe queue compacts topic logs on a fixed cycle. Plugins cannot disable compaction or extend retention beyond the tenant quota. Oversized segments are split before compaction; keys above the size cap are rejected at produce time. Compaction lag is visible via the stats hook but not configurable per plugin. All plugins are bound by the constants listed here.

tuning table, yajog-yahof:
BUDGETS = {
    "lamvan": 303,
    "wenox": 460,
    "fenvan": 525,
}

- [ ] **Step 7: Breaker override escrow.** After sealing the signing keys for the Tallgrove upstream API circuit breaker, confirm the support team can force the breaker open during a full outage. The override bundle lives in the sealed escrow drawer and is useless without its unlock phrase. Two ceremony witnesses must initial this step before proceeding. The escrow bundle is decrypted with the recovery passphrase that follows.

vault phrase of kahip-kahop = holath-quenmir

## Runbook: Encoding Detection for Uploaded Text Files

When TextGate flags an upload as "encoding ambiguous," the detector service re-scans with an extended codec table. Support can trigger a re-scan from the admin panel; results appear within a minute. If re-scans fail with auth errors, the detector's env file is likely missing its service credential, which belongs on the next line.

vault entry, yahif-yajep: COURIER_KEY29=b802bdf8034096b65a51c6ba5abe2

Subject: Handover — Quickpair matching service

Taking over from me Friday. Main open item: GC pauses on the match nodes spike to 400ms under load; the tuning branch is merged but unreleased. Ship it in 5.1 and watch latency dashboards. Rollback plan is in the runbook. Sign the release with the key below.

signing key of bagap-yawep = bky13_TbfT6ZMUoGJo2

**Encoding detection, quick intro.** When users upload text files to Driftnote, the Sniffler service guesses the encoding (UTF-8 first, then a frequency-based fallback). Most pages get it right; mojibake tickets usually mean the fallback picked wrong. If you're on call and it's paging, the runbook lives right here.

wiki page, tahaf-tajog: https://jira.ordindyn.corp/pipeline